This is an obtuse opinion IMO. Do you really think internet crimes reduced robberies. What do you have to say about the higher rates of rituals and killings brought on by Yahoo plus boys insatiable craze for money.

FYI, Crime rate is on the rise, the robbers simply switched tactics. Cashless/electronic economy means people don't stash cash at home no more which was the main cause of home burglaries. Now, theives have switched to mugging, stealing expensive phones, one-chance etc and now improving on how to wipe people's accounts/ virtual cash.

Without Yahoo, Nigerians will have more credibility abroad today and believe in patient legit work for rewards and not getting rich off innocent people's sweat.
